How to Make Air Fryer Sweet Chili Salmon

Step 1: Prepare the Salmon

Pat the salmon fillets dry with paper towels to help the seasoning stick better. Lightly brush or spray the salmon with olive oil to promote even crisping in the air fryer.

Step 2: Mix the Sweet Chili Glaze

In a small bowl, combine sweet chili sauce, soy sauce, garlic powder, and freshly squeezed lime juice. Stir well until all ingredients are fully blended into a flavorful glaze.

Step 3: Coat the Salmon

Generously brush the glaze over the salmon fillets, making sure each piece is nicely coated for maximum flavor.

Step 4: Air Fry the Salmon

Place the salmon fillets in the air fryer basket skin side down, making sure they don’t overlap. Set the air fryer to 400°F (200°C) and cook for 8-10 minutes, depending on thickness, until the salmon flakes easily with a fork and has a beautiful caramelized sheen.

Step 5: Garnish and Serve

Once cooked, remove the salmon carefully and garnish with chopped green onions, sesame seeds, or fresh cilantro for added texture and color, then serve immediately.

Pro Tips for Making Air Fryer Sweet Chili Salmon

  • Preheat the Air Fryer: For a crispier finish, always preheat your air fryer before cooking the salmon.
  • Don’t Overcrowd: Space out salmon fillets in the basket to ensure even cooking and crisping on all sides.
  • Use a Thermometer: Check the internal temperature of salmon with a food thermometer; it should reach 145°F (63°C) for perfectly cooked fish.
  • Adjust Cooking Time for Thickness: Thicker fillets will need a couple more minutes, so keep an eye on them.
  • Glaze Twice: For extra flavor, brush a second layer of the sweet chili glaze halfway through the cooking process.

Make Ahead and Storage

Storing Leftovers

Place any leftover salmon in an airtight container and store it in the refrigerator. It’s best consumed within 2 days to maintain freshness and flavor.

Freezing

You can freeze cooked salmon by wrapping it tightly in plastic wrap and then placing it in a freezer-safe bag. Frozen salmon will keep well for up to 2 months; thaw overnight in the fridge before reheating.

Reheating

Reheat salmon gently in the air fryer or oven at a low temperature to avoid drying it out. Avoid microwaving to maintain the best texture and flavor.

FAQs

Can I use frozen salmon fillets for this recipe?

Yes! Just thaw them completely before cooking to ensure even cooking and optimal texture in the air fryer.

How spicy is the sweet chili sauce?

Sweet chili sauce has a mild to moderate heat level with a sweet tang, but you can easily adjust the spice by adding chili flakes or reducing the sauce amount.

Is the skin edible on the salmon?

Absolutely! Cooking with the skin on in the air fryer produces a deliciously crispy layer that adds texture and flavor.

Can I make this recipe without an air fryer?

Yes, bake the salmon in the oven at 400°F (200°C) for about 12-15 minutes, but the air fryer will give you a crispier texture faster.

What can I substitute if I don’t have sweet chili sauce?

You can mix honey or maple syrup with a bit of chili garlic sauce to mimic the sweet and spicy flavor if you don’t have sweet chili sauce on hand.

Ingredients

Main Ingredients

  • Fresh salmon fillets, skin on (quantity as desired)
  • Sweet chili sauce (about 3 tablespoons)
  • Soy sauce (1 tablespoon)
  • Garlic powder (1/2 teaspoon)
  • Fresh lime juice (1 tablespoon)
  • Olive oil or cooking spray (enough to lightly coat the salmon)

Optional Garnishes

  • Chopped green onions
  • Sesame seeds
  • Fresh cilantro

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Salmon: Pat the salmon fillets dry with paper towels to help the seasoning stick better. Lightly brush or spray the salmon with olive oil to promote even crisping in the air fryer.
  2. Mix the Sweet Chili Glaze: In a small bowl, combine sweet chili sauce, soy sauce, garlic powder, and freshly squeezed lime juice. Stir well until all ingredients are fully blended into a flavorful glaze.
  3. Coat the Salmon: Generously brush the glaze over the salmon fillets, making sure each piece is nicely coated for maximum flavor.
  4. Air Fry the Salmon: Place the salmon fillets in the air fryer basket skin side down, making sure they don’t overlap. Set the air fryer to 400°F (200°C) and cook for 8-10 minutes, depending on thickness, until the salmon flakes easily with a fork and has a beautiful caramelized sheen.
  5. Garnish and Serve: Once cooked, remove the salmon carefully and garnish with chopped green onions, sesame seeds, or fresh cilantro for added texture and color, then serve immediately.
